What is MANTECOL?
Mantecol is a type of semi-soft nougat very popular in Argentina, which resembles Greek halva, but made with peanuts instead of sesame. It is a traditional sweet, especially consumed during the Christmas and New Year's holidays.
Characteristics of Mantecol:Ingredients:
Its main base is peanut paste, together with other ingredients such as glucose syrup, sugar, oil and egg whites.
Texture:
Its texture is semi-soft, with a melt-in-the-mouth consistency.
Origin:
It is believed that mantecol originated in Argentina as an adaptation of Greek halva by the Greek immigrant Miguel Nomikos Georgalos.
Consumption:
It is a very popular treat in Argentina, especially during the Christmas holidays.
